As a Director of Clinical Care, you will:
- Lead & Develop Clinical Teams
- Train, mentor, and evaluate staff while maintaining effective scheduling and staffing systems. Provide leadership, problem-solving support, and ongoing professional development to ensure high-quality care.
- Ensure High-Quality Resident Care
- Oversee resident well-being by collaborating with interdisciplinary team members, supporting clinical goals, and providing hands-on care as needed. Foster strong communication with residents and families.
- Maintain Compliance & Clinical Standards
- Implement best practices, ensure regulatory compliance, and manage medical records accuracy. Coordinate resident clinical needs with internal teams and external healthcare providers.
- Foster Communication & Improvement
- Promote transparency, teamwork, and process improvement to enhance care quality and organizational efficiency. Represent Vivie in industry events and committees as needed.

This job also requires:
- Registered Nurse (RN) license in the state of Minnesota.
- Minimum 3 years of leadership experience in clinical care, assisted living, long-term care, or home health.
- Proficient using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ook)
- Demonstrated expertise in Electronic Health Record (EHR) software, with a solid understanding of patient data management, scheduling, and charting systems.
- Knowledge of assisted living regulations and compliance standards.
- Knowledge of nursing best practices, regulatory compliance, and care coordination.
- Ability to pass state mandated background check.
- Physical capability to perform all essential job functions.
- Ability to read, write, and speak English to ensure effective communication with residents, families, and staff.
